WebApr 22, 2024 · There are 2 types of mover for a twin, either 4 wheel drive or 2 wheel drive, the first is twice as heavy and a fair bit more expensive, but will turn the van better. It will use at least 60kg of your available payload, how much do you have available? WebEngage the parking brake. Only then disengage the Mover from the tyres. To do this, press the buttons (h) simultaneously for about three seconds. When the rollers start moving away from the tyres, release the buttons. Switch off the remote control with the on/off switch (a) on the right-hand side.
WebA caravan motor mover is powered by the leisure battery and is clamped to a caravans chassis and connect to rollers attached to the caravan wheels allowing you to control what direction a caravan goes in with a touch of a button. There are two types of motor movers; manual or auto engaged. WebUsing the caravan leisure battery, the rollers operate against the individual caravan tyres to give full manoeuvrability of the caravan, all operated via a remote control unit.
